Olubadan Charges New Titleholders On Progress, Development

Olubadan of Ibadanland, Oba Lekan Balogun Alli Okunmade II has charged title holders on progress, development of the ancient town and Oyo State in general.

The monarch urged them to see the titles bestowed on them as responsibilities towards the progress, growth and development of Ibadanland and that they should at all times prioritize Ibadan interests.

He gave this charge at the installation of three eminent personalities, Chief (Mrs.) Janet Raimi as Asiwaju Oloja of Oyo State, Chief Laja Akintayo and Chief (Mrs) Olukemi Akintayo as Jagunmolu and Yeye Jagunmolu Apesinola of Ibadanland and Chief (Mrs). Sefiat Olatoyosi Adetoyese as Yeye-Oba of Ibadanland.

The new title holders, who were said to be considered for the exalted titles based on their past activities were enjoined not to relent in making their relevance felt in Ibadanland as he prayed for them to live long in robust and sound health.

In his reaction to the new titles bestowed on him and his wife, the Jagunmolu Apesinola of Ibadanland, Chief Akintayo praised Oba Balogun for the honour done him and his wife with a pledge to continue doing his best for his fatherland despite the fact that he is based in the US.

“It doesn’t affect me because I’m part and parcel of Ibadanland through the activities of CCII, through the activities of Ibadan Descendants’ Union and many others.

So, this chieftaincy title has challenged me again to make sure I do more and give back to Ibadanland.

“I will mobilize other people, especially in Diaspora to make Ibadan bigger than what it is and make sure that Ibadanland maintains its status as a Pace Setter state. It is our town and it is big, so there is the need to contribute our own quota to its development.

“I have been contributing my own quota to the progress of Ibadan in the past 40 years and I will continue to be doing that. So, I pray to God to give me more strength”, the new Jagunmolu Apesinola added.

On her part, the newly installed Yeye-Oba, Chief (Mrs). Adetoyese said she was elated by the title which was a function of a long lasting relationship between her and Ibadanland in general and Olubadan in particular saying, “it is a big responsibility which I have come to accept with every sense of commitment and humility. I know the enormity of the responsibility demanded by the title and I promise not to let down Kabiyesi and Ibadanland”.
